What Small Brown Bird Is Known For Chirping?

When it comes to the world of small brown birds, one species that stands out for its melodious chirping is the House Sparrow. These tiny creatures are a common sight in many urban areas, known for their lively presence and distinctive vocalizations.

The House Sparrow, scientifically known as Passer domesticus, is easily recognizable by its small size and brown plumage. Both male and female House Sparrows sport shades of brown on their feathers, while the males boast a striking black spot on their chests.

What sets the House Sparrow apart from other small brown birds is its remarkable chirping abilities. These birds are incredibly vocal, producing a variety of loud chirps that can be heard from a distance. Their distinctive calls add charm to any environment they inhabit.

Male House Sparrows are particularly known for their spirited singing, using their voices to establish territories and attract mates during the breeding season. Their chirping is a combination of rhythmic patterns and high-pitched notes that are both soothing and captivating to listen to.
